#375cf0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#375cf0 is composed of 21.6% red, 36.1%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.1% cyan, 61.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 57.8%. #375cf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#6eb8ff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#375cf0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#375cf0 has RGB values of R:55, G:92,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 3628272.

Shades and Tints of #375cf0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#edf1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#375cf0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929395 is the less saturated color, while #2f57f8 is the most saturated one.
